Hi,

Just wondering if back seat access is restricted when fitting cobra seats and new runners to a clubman. The clubman seats move forward and tilt forward so just wondering how the cobra runners work?

Also what is the best method for repairing floor holes when removing a roll bar?

I have low back Cobras in my GT

They do slide forward and lift up from the rear. But is a little harder to get in and out of due to the shape of the seat.

If it's only bolt holes I would use a blob of Sika and paint over it.

Why not just put some shorter S/Steel cup head type bolts with rubber washers on them in the holes?

You could just use rubber bungs.....

Or pull the welder out and weld them up (if you have one)
